Web5 nov. 2024 · Calculate productivity. Just divide the GDP by the total productive hours. The result will give you the productivity for that country. For example, if the country's GDP is $100 billion and the productive hours are 4 billion, then the productivity is $100 billion / 4 billion or $25 of output per hour worked. WebGDP per hour worked GDP per hour worked is a measure of labour productivity. It measures how efficiently labour input is combined with other factors of production and used in the production process. Labour input is defined as total hours worked of all persons engaged in production. Web10 feb. 2024 · PRODUCTIVITY = total revenue ÷ total cost.
